import ProductCard from '@/components/product/ProductCard';
import type { CmsSlot } from '@/components/cms/types';

export default function CmsElementProductBox({ slot }: { slot: CmsSlot }) {
  const product = slot.data?.product;
  if (!product) return <div className="bg-surface-50 rounded-xl aspect-square animate-pulse" />;
  return <ProductCard product={product} />;
}
